IMO, Starfield of Nyx just didn't ever feel needed to me, not after we got Overwhelming Splendor and Cruel Reality/Sandwurm printed. Beating fair decks used to involve Deed recursion but Splendor does such a better, simpler job. Again, opponent's don't have answers game 1, so at best it'd be a sideboard card. When were were slower and running with Groves and killable enchantment creatures (Doomwake, for instance), it felt much more necessary.

Sandwurm could be tried instead of Cruel, they cover very similar situations but I've enjoyed immediately killing Jace's with Cruel.
